The humble oyster has many roles in our environment including filtering and recycling area waters, nutrient regulators, creating habitat, denitrification and shoreline stabilization. Oysters are also architects of reefs, which support many different and important species. Learn about this exciting project and how you can participate in the future of the local oyster.
